Driving Forces: What's Propelling the AOI Tricolor Light Source Market?

Several key factors are propelling the growth of the AOI tricolor light source market. Firstly, the relentless demand for higher quality and precision in manufacturing, particularly within the electronics industry, is a major driver. Manufacturers are constantly striving to reduce defect rates and improve overall product yield, necessitating the implementation of advanced inspection technologies like AOI systems equipped with tricolor light sources. These sources provide significantly improved contrast and clarity, allowing for the detection of subtle defects that might be missed by traditional single-wavelength illumination. Secondly, the increasing complexity of electronic components is another critical factor. As devices become smaller and more intricate, the ability to detect minute defects becomes even more crucial. Tricolor light sources excel in this regard, offering the resolution and sensitivity required for inspecting complex, densely packed components. Thirdly, advancements in AOI technology itself are driving market growth. The integration of sophisticated algorithms, improved image processing techniques, and the development of more compact and user-friendly AOI systems are making these technologies increasingly accessible and cost-effective for a wider range of manufacturers. Finally, the increasing adoption of Industry 4.0 principles and smart manufacturing strategies further fuels demand. The need for real-time data acquisition, automated defect detection, and seamless integration with other manufacturing processes makes AOI systems, and specifically those employing tricolor light sources, an essential element of modern manufacturing environments.

Challenges and Restraints in AOI Tricolor Light Source Market

Despite the significant growth potential, the AOI tricolor light source market faces certain challenges and restraints. High initial investment costs associated with implementing AOI systems can be a barrier to entry for smaller manufacturers, particularly those with limited capital budgets. The need for specialized expertise to operate and maintain these sophisticated systems also poses a challenge, requiring significant training and ongoing support. Furthermore, the complexity of integrating AOI systems into existing manufacturing workflows can present logistical hurdles and require substantial modifications to existing production lines. Competition from alternative inspection methods, such as X-ray inspection or manual visual inspection, also poses a challenge. While tricolor light sources offer significant advantages, these alternative methods may be more cost-effective or suitable for specific applications. Finally, the ongoing evolution of technology requires manufacturers of AOI tricolor light sources to continuously innovate and adapt to remain competitive. Keeping pace with technological advancements necessitates significant investment in research and development, potentially impacting profitability margins. Overcoming these challenges will be crucial for realizing the full potential of the AOI tricolor light source market.
